As President, Mr. Wurtz oversees all operations of Aegis Corporation
and serves as the direct head of operations for the administrator for
the underwriting, claims management and accounting functions. He is
responsible for the negotiation and securing of reinsurance for the
various programs administered by Aegis Corporation.
Mr. Wurtz serves as a major consultant to the Board of Directors and
the Underwriting Committee for the Wisconsin County Mutual Insurance
Corporation. He also serves as a consultant to the Investment Committee
of the County Mutual.
As underwriting executive, Mr. Wurtz’ duties include structure,
design and implementation of client programs which return profit to
clients. In support of client programs, Mr. Wurtz is responsible for
data accumulation, organization, and analysis for pricing and reserving
for presentation to actuaries. He also designed and implemented Aegis
Corporation’s Risk Management Information System (RMIS) database,
which is utilized by the Wisconsin County Mutual Insurance Corporation.
With over 30 years experience in the insurance and risk management
industry, Mr. Wurtz previously served as Vice President of the
Association and Special Risks Department of Frank B. Hall and Company.
Prior, he was the Underwriting Manager at CNA for the company’s
Milwaukee and Detroit offices. He holds a Bachelor of Arts Degree from
the University of Minnesota and has had a Chartered Property and
Casualty Underwriter (CPCU) designation since 1972.

As the General Administrator of the Wisconsin County Mutual Insurance
Corporation, Mr. Dirkse oversees all phases of the daily operations of
the County Mutual. His specific responsibilities include acting as a
major consultant to clients’ loss prevention committees, claims review
committees and underwriting committees. As a consultant to the loss
prevention committees, Mr. Dirkse is responsible for recommendations and
maintenance of the risk management programs and training of clients’
personnel responsible for risk management and supervisory functions.
Mr. Dirkse and his staff of professional risk management and loss
control consultants conduct over 300 client-oriented, in-service
training seminars annually. These sessions consist of
department-specific training on topics such as CDL drug and alcohol
programs, blood borne pathogens education and awareness, sexual
harassment/diversity/sensitivity training, and conflict resolution in
the workplace. They also perform loss control inspections and videotape
loss control environments.
In addition to his other responsibilities, Mr. Dirkse has a primary
responsibility for the direct marketing activities of the Wisconsin
County Mutual Insurance Corporation and other clients.
Mr. Dirkse has nearly 30 years experience in the insurance and risk
management industry, serving most recently as Assistant Vice President
of the Association and Special Risks Department of Aegis Corporation and
Company. Prior, he was an Account Executive for Alexander and Alexander,
Inc., a major international insurance brokerage and risk management
services organization. Mr. Dirkse began his career with Liberty Mutual
Insurance Company as a Worker’s Compensation Specialist.
